Pelosi tells Michael Jackson resolution to beat it
The Washington Examiner ^
| 07-09-2009
| Susan Ferrechio
Posted on 07/09/2009 11:59:47 AM PDT by theruleshavechanged
House Speaker Nancy Pelosi, D-Calif., said the House will not take up a resolution honoring the Michael Jackson because doing so would open up the floor to a potential barrage of criticism about the late pop star and the controversies that plagued his life.
